We are seeking a reliable and dedicated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ant to joinour Pediatric CVICU Teamat Riley Children's Health!
Position Details:
- Full-Time, Rotating Shifts
- 3x12hour shifts per week
- Rotating days, nights, and every 4th weekend and some holiday commitments (Mostly dayshifts approximately 5-night shifts per month)
- No Call
- Inpatient: 100%
- Patient population includes Pediatric patients with congenital heart disease, including some adult patients with the same.
Key Responsibilities:
- Dailly rounding on ICUand some stepdown patients
- Admissions
- Daily progress notes
- Managing and carrying out plan of care
Qualifications:
- Master's Degree required
- FNP, PNP, or PAcertification required
- Seeking an experienced APP with pediatric critical care experience required
- Ideal provider would have pediatric CVICU experience and be a team player with a passion for pediatric congenital heart disease patients and their families.
